British standard BS AU 145d character spacing requirements
The technical specifications governing number plate construction fall under British Standard BS AU 145d (recently updated to BS AU 145e), which establishes precise measurements for every aspect of plate design. Character height must measure exactly 79mm, whilst width specifications require 50mm for most letters and numbers, with exceptions for the narrower characters ‘I’ and ‘1’. The stroke width of each character must maintain a consistent 14mm thickness throughout.
Spacing requirements prove equally exacting, with 11mm mandated between individual characters within the same group and a larger 33mm gap required between the area code/age identifier and the final three random letters. These measurements were calculated to optimise recognition rates for both human observers and early-generation ANPR cameras, though technological advances have since reduced the necessity for such stringent uniformity.
Penalties for Non-Compliant registration mark display
Current enforcement mechanisms impose substantial financial consequences for spacing violations, with fixed penalty notices reaching up to £1,000 for non-compliant displays. This penalty level reflects the government’s previous stance that registration marks serve as crucial vehicle identification tools that must remain unambiguous under all circumstances. Traffic enforcement officers possess discretionary powers to issue immediate fines, though prosecution rates vary significantly between different police force areas.
The severity of these penalties has created what many industry observers describe as a disproportionate punishment system, where minor spacing adjustments carry the same financial consequences as more serious traffic violations. Legal challenges to these penalties have generally proved unsuccessful, with courts consistently upholding the principle that clear vehicle identification takes precedence over aesthetic preferences.

MOT test failure criteria for number plate formatting
MOT testing centres must examine number plate compliance as part of their standard inspection procedure, with incorrect spacing constituting an automatic failure. This requirement places additional burden on vehicle owners who may unknowingly purchase non-compliant plates from unregistered suppliers. Test centres report varying interpretation of spacing requirements, leading to inconsistent enforcement that frustrates both motorists and testing personnel.
The integration of plate compliance into MOT testing creates a cyclical enforcement mechanism, where vehicles with spacing violations must rectify issues before receiving roadworthiness certification. This system effectively prevents the long-term use of non-compliant plates, though it also imposes additional costs and inconvenience on vehicle owners who may have invested significantly in personalised registrations.
